On Wed, Mar 22, 2017 at 02:32:35PM +0100, Igor Mammedov wrote:
> Introduce machine_set_cpu_numa_node() helper that stores
> node mapping for CPU in MachineState::possible_cpus.
> CPU and node it belongs to is specified by 'props' argument.
> 
> Patch doesn't remove old way of storing mapping in
> numa_info[X].node_cpu as removing it at the same time
> makes patch rather big. Instead it just mirrors mapping
> in possible_cpus and follow up per target patches will
> switch to possible_cpus and numa_info[X].node_cpu will
> be removed once there isn't any users left.

So, this patch is the one that makes "-numa" and "-numa cpu"
affect query-hotpluggable-cpus output.

Before this patch:

  $ qemu-system-x86_64 -smp 2 -m 2G -numa node -numa node -numa node -numa node
  [run qmp-shell]
  (QEMU) query-hotpluggable-cpus
  {
      "return": [
          {
              "qom-path": "/machine/unattached/device[2]",
              "type": "qemu64-x86_64-cpu",
              "vcpus-count": 1,
              "props": {
                  "socket-id": 1,
                  "core-id": 0,
                  "thread-id": 0
              }
          },
          {
              "qom-path": "/machine/unattached/device[0]",
              "type": "qemu64-x86_64-cpu",
              "vcpus-count": 1,
              "props": {
                  "socket-id": 0,
                  "core-id": 0,
                  "thread-id": 0
              }
          }
      ]
  }


After this patch:

  $ qemu-system-x86_64 -smp 2 -m 2G -numa node -numa node -numa node -numa node
  [run qmp-shell]
  (QEMU) query-hotpluggable-cpus
  {
      "return": [
          {
              "qom-path": "/machine/unattached/device[2]",
              "type": "qemu64-x86_64-cpu",
              "vcpus-count": 1,
              "props": {
                  "socket-id": 1,
                  "node-id": 1,
                  "core-id": 0,
                  "thread-id": 0
              }
          },
          {
              "qom-path": "/machine/unattached/device[0]",
              "type": "qemu64-x86_64-cpu",
              "vcpus-count": 1,
              "props": {
                  "socket-id": 0,
                  "node-id": 0,
                  "core-id": 0,
                  "thread-id": 0
              }
          }
      ]
  }


As noted in another message, I am not sure we really should make
"-numa" affect query-hotpluggable-cpus output unconditionally (I
believe we shouldn't). But we do, we need to document this very
clearly.
